Nacro is a national Social Justice Charity with more than 50 years' experience of changing lives, building stronger communities, and working with stakeholders towards reducing crime.

Nacro delivers the Community Accommodation Support service (CAS), a national service across England and Wales. The service enables Courts to make greater use of bail by providing accommodation in the community with support for adult defendants who could not otherwise be bailed. CAS also supports adults released from custody in the last three months of their sentence on Home Detention Curfew (HDC) and other Licence Orders.

The team provides flexible and holistic support to residents with diverse support needs. Our goal is to help residents find and maintain stable housing at the end of their CAS-2 placement. You will manage a caseload of residents and properties within your allocated area.

Duties and responsibilities include, but are not limited to:

* Supporting clients to comply with their HDC/Bail conditions.
* Producing realistic and achievable Support Plans, including accessing and utilizing housing and accommodation services to facilitate move-on to longer-term housing.
* Ensuring all Support Plans and Risk Assessments are person-centred, inclusive, and tailored to individual needs.
* Providing weekly support to residents to engage with their support plans and work towards their objectives and aspirations.
* Assisting residents in accessing Housing Benefit to prevent tenancy issues and rent arrears.
* Managing properties to ensure they meet Decent Homes Standard by reporting repairs and replacing furniture and equipment as needed.
* Undertaking basic cleaning tasks as required.

Key Responsibilities

* Planning and delivering effective, person-centred Support and Safety Plans.
* Providing up to 2 hours of weekly support sessions to help residents achieve their goals.
* Maintaining accurate and up-to-date resident records.
* Supporting Housing Benefit applications for residents.
* Referring residents to specialist support agencies when necessary.
* Liaising with partner agencies such as Probation, Prison Services, Courts, and Police as needed.
* Ensuring properties are well-equipped, maintained, furnished, and clean.
* Empowering and motivating residents to achieve desired outcomes.
* Developing move-on plans with residents early, identifying realistic future housing options.
